Cops make a gruesome discovery in burnt-out car in Sydney suburb - sparking an urgent investigation

A body has been discovered in a burnt out car, sparking a police investigation in Sydney’s south-west.

Emergency services were called to Welfare Avenue in Beverly Hills at 11.30pm on Thursday night to find a car on fire.

Fire crews put out the blaze, however, a body was found in the destroyed vehicle.
